Caity Maverick is a nurse who takes care of her young daughter all on her own at the age of twenty five. She has her life quite on track, until that one patient she thought she never had to see ever again is admitted under her care...

While memories of a past she has tried to forget about flood her with emotions, she tries to keep her guard up and not give in to the feelings she gets from seeing him again.

But what if her resistance starts to crumble every time she is near him? What if he is determined not to let her go again, and tries so desperately to make her change her mind about him?

Will their future be brighter than their past? Find out what happens when two people decide to never give up on true love, even though life drags them through some of the hardest times they ever experienced.
